Immunoglobulin abnormalities in malignant non-Hodgkin's lymphoma
Scandinavian Journal of Haematology
|August 1, 1984
Summary
This study found that 24% of patients with chronic lymphocytic leukemia (CLL) and non-Hodgkin's lymphoma (NHL) had monoclonal immunoglobulins (Ig). The presence of monoclonal gammopathy in NHL indicates the differentiation stage of the malignant B-cell clone.

Background:
- Monoclonal gammopathy is the presence of abnormal proteins in the blood.
- Non-Hodgkin's lymphoma (NHL) and chronic lymphocytic leukemia (CLL) are types of B-cell malignancies.
Purpose of the Study:
- To investigate the association between monoclonal gammopathy and B-cell lymphomas.
- To determine the incidence of monoclonal immunoglobulins (Ig) in patients with CLL and NHL.
Main Methods:
- Studied 100 untreated patients with CLL and B-cell NHL.
- Classified lymphomas using Lukes & Collins criteria.
- Assessed the presence and type of monoclonal immunoglobulins (Ig).
Main Results:
- Overall incidence of monoclonal Ig was 24% in the studied cohort.
- Highest incidence (57%) observed in plasmacytoid lymphocytic lymphoma.
- Lowest incidence (7.9%) found in CLL cases, with IgM being the predominant monoclonal Ig class.
Conclusions:
- Monoclonal gammopathy in NHL correlates with the differentiation and maturation stage of the malignant B-cell clone.
- Findings suggest a link between B-cell maturation and the development of monoclonal gammopathy in these malignancies.
